Forest Grove Rural Fire Protection District

The Forest Grove Rural Fire Protection District provides fire protection and emergency medical services to the residents of Forest Grove and surrounding areas in Washington County, Oregon.

Established to safeguard the community, the Forest Grove Rural Fire Protection District has a long-standing commitment to protecting lives and property through fire suppression, emergency medical services, and public education. The district is staffed by dedicated professionals and volunteers who are trained to respond to a variety of emergencies. Their mission is to deliver high-quality service with integrity, professionalism, and respect. They also engage in community outreach and education programs to promote fire safety and prevention.
